Description

The wpForo Forum WordPress plugin before 3.1.2 does not sanitize and escape a user profile field before outputting it inside an HTML attribute on the public participant profile page, allowing users with a subscriber-level account to inject JavaScript that executes in the browser of any visitor who views the profile, including a logged-in administrator.

Impact Analysis

An attacker with subscriber access could steal session cookies, redirect users to malicious sites, or perform actions on their behalf. Visitors viewing a compromised profile may have their browsers hijacked, leading to unauthorized access to sensitive data or account takeover if they are logged-in administrators.

Mitigation Strategies

Update the wpForo plugin to version 3.1.2 or later. Remove or sanitize any suspicious JavaScript from user profiles. Review subscriber accounts for unauthorized changes. Consider temporarily disabling user profile editing until patched.
